You don't need any software installed on the windows PC. Just plug it into the Ethernet port on the router to the Ethernet port on the NIC card. If you want the Fios software installed go to activatemyfios.verizon.net and click configure another computer and enter your fios user name and password. If you are having connection problems go to verizon.com/connectionwizard and install that software.
